With a Grateful Heart

I really liked the background wood and was feeling justified that I just bought an entire 6x6 pad of weathered wood paper (KaiserCraft Base Coat)!!  I also wanted to capture the twiggy wreath with pops of color.  I used Papertrey Ink's A Wreath for All Seasons, but the dot layer of the wreath is quite dense.  So I used some small Memento Dew Drops to just splash a variety of colors on the stamp.
